I just wanna share with you a great album I've been listening to from Sigur Rós, Ágætis byrjun. I wanted to expand my knowledge in post-rock other than GY!BE, and I've heard people recommend this album.
I've been listening to it over and over for the past 1.5 weeks because its soundscape is just sooo amazing. The whole album is a no-skip for me (apart from Intro, the first song), it sounds so cinematic and sublime. It makes me feel like I'm standing on the sea coast, just staring towards the water. For me, the first five songs are the best on the album, but that doesn't mean the rest are bad either.
If you're interested in gorgeously composed soundtrack for film (or other type of media) that doesn't exist, I can wholeheartedly recommend this album.
Also, the fact that they're singing in Icelandic on the album makes it sound all the more beautiful. It's interesting too, as the post-rock genre is known to be usually instrumental music, this album breaks tradition. As I don't speak the language, I can only imagine how it sounds to a native speaker. But even as a non-native, it sounds hauntingly beautiful.
